The Emergence and Industry Impact of Progressive Web Apps
| Criteria | Traditional Native Apps | Progressive Web Apps |
|---|---|---|
| Development Cost | High (multiple platforms, extensive resources) | Lower (single codebase, cross-platform) |
| Distribution | App Stores, manual downloads | Web browsers, URL sharing |
| User Experience | Optimized for specific OS | Adaptive, responsive across devices |
| Update Deployment | Manual updates through app stores | Instant updates via server |

Interactive Gaming on the Web: A Paradigm Shift
The gaming industry exemplifies the transformative potential of PWAs. Traditional downloadable games, despite their rich content, often struggle with fragmentation, lengthy installation, and platform restrictions. PWAs, however, break down these barriers, offering instant access, seamless updates, and device agnosticism.

Technical Significance and Future Outlook
From a technical standpoint, the integration of PWAs like ShootStrike Coin Rain demonstrates how web-based games can rival native applications—achieving low latency, engaging graphics, and reliable performance. This convergence is critical, as it allows developers to reach wider audiences without the friction associated with app store approvals and platform-specific development cycles.
Furthermore, leveraging web technologies ensures the ease of deployment and iteration. The continuous evolution of browser capabilities and web standards — including WebAssembly and WebGL — further enhances the potential of PWAs to deliver high-fidelity interactive experiences.
